Opinion

In re Prudential Property & Cas. Ins.;— Defendant(s); applying for supervisory and/or remedial writs; Parish of East Baton Rouge, 19th Judicial District Court, Div. “A”, No. 408,974; to the Court of Appeal, First Circuit, No. CW97 1923.

Granted. The case is remanded to the court of appeal for briefing, argument and opinion.

VICTORY, J., not on panel.
